{-|
Module : Simple
Copyright : Jan Hamal Dvořák
License : AGPL-3
Maintainer : mordae@anilinux.org
Stability : unstable
Portability : non-portable (ghc)
Demonstration of a simple stateful web service built using Hikaru.
Simple /= Easy /= Short. Happy reading.
-}
{-# LANGUAGE OverloadedStrings #-}
{-# LANGUAGE GeneralizedNewtypeDeriving #-}
module Simple (main)
where
import Control.Concurrent.MVar
import Control.Monad.Reader
import Data.Text (Text)
import Lucid
import Network.HTTP.Types.Status
import Network.Wai
import Network.Wai.Handler.Warp
import Network.Wai.Middleware.RequestLogger
import Web.Hikaru
-- Action ------------------------------------------------------------------
-- |
-- Our custom action monad allows us to inspect request,
-- build response and consult the model at the same time.
--
newtype Action a
= Action
{ unAction :: ReaderT DemoEnv IO a
}
deriving (Functor, Applicative, Monad, MonadIO)
instance MonadAction Action where
getActionEnv = Action (demoActionEnv <$> ask)
instance MonadModel Action where
getModelEnv = Action (demoModelEnv <$> ask)
data DemoEnv
= DemoEnv
{ demoActionEnv :: ActionEnv
, demoModelEnv :: ModelEnv
}
-- Model -------------------------------------------------------------------
class (MonadIO m) => MonadModel m where
getModelEnv :: m ModelEnv
data ModelEnv
= ModelEnv
{ modelCounter :: MVar Word
}
makeModelEnv :: Word -> IO ModelEnv
makeModelEnv n = ModelEnv <$> newMVar n
countVisitor :: (MonadModel m) => m Word
countVisitor = do
counter <- modelCounter <$> getModelEnv
liftIO $ do
modifyMVar_ counter (return . succ)
readMVar counter
-- Dispatching -------------------------------------------------------------
runAction :: ModelEnv -> Action () -> Application
runAction me act = do
respond $ \ae -> do
runReaderT (unAction act) (DemoEnv ae me)
makeApplication :: ModelEnv -> Application
makeApplication me = do
dispatch (runAction me) $ do
-- Register nicer error handlers.
handler NotFound handleNotFound
-- Plug in a cool logging middleware.
middleware $ logStdoutDev
-- Negotiate content for the root page.
route $ getRootHtmlR <$ get <* offerHTML
route $ getRootTextR <$ get <* offerText
-- Present a simple greeting page.
route $ getHelloR <$ get <* seg "hello" <*> arg
<* offerText
-- Create an echoing JSON API.
route $ postEchoR <$ post <* seg "api" <* seg "echo"
<* offerJSON <* acceptJSON
-- Handlers ----------------------------------------------------------------
getRootHtmlR :: Action ()
getRootHtmlR = do
-- Update the counter.
n <- countVisitor
-- Present fancy HTML result.
sendHTML $ do
h1_ "Welcome!"
p_ $ "You are " >> toHtml (show n) >> ". visitor!"
getRootTextR :: Action ()
getRootTextR = do
-- Update the counter.
n <- countVisitor
-- Present a plain textual result.
sendString $ unlines [ "Welcome!"
, "You are " <> show n <> ". visitor!"
]
postEchoR :: Action ()
postEchoR = sendJSON =<< getJSON
getHelloR :: Text -> Action ()
getHelloR name = sendText $ "Hello, " <> name <> "!"
handleNotFound :: RequestError -> Text -> Action ()
handleNotFound _exn msg = do
setStatus status404
sendHTML $ do
h1_ "404 Not Found"
p_ (toHtml msg)
-- Serving -----------------------------------------------------------------
main :: IO ()
main = do
putStrLn "Listening (port 5000) ..."
model <- makeModelEnv 0
run 5000 (makeApplication model)
-- vim:set ft=haskell sw=2 ts=2 et:
